Set within the lush heart of North Brabant, Oisterwijk invites discerning property buyers with its harmonious blend of woodland, lakes, and understated elegance. The region’s reputation for refined residential estates, coupled with a vibrant yet serene local culture, draws both families and investors seeking lasting value. Oisterwijk’s leafy avenues and historical architecture set the tone for an exclusive living environment, offering effortless access to outstanding gastronomy, boutique shopping, and outdoor pursuits. For those looking to secure an address where natural beauty and contemporary comfort coexist, Oisterwijk represents a rare proposition—an enclave respected for its privacy, quality of life, and timeless charm.
The luxury property market in Oisterwijk attracts steady interest from both national and international buyers, drawn to its tranquil setting and architectural heritage.
Demand remains robust, especially for secluded estates and renovated manor homes, with transaction timelines often favoring properties presented in pristine condition. Price trends reflect sustained appetite for privacy and proximity to nature, while inventory remains purposefully limited to maintain character and exclusivity.
Preferred neighborhoods include leafy lanes near the “Oisterwijkse Bossen en Vennen” nature reserve and the exclusive enclaves on the town's southwestern edge, known for their mature landscaping and limited through traffic. Traditional Dutch farmhouses, thatched-roof villas, and architect-designed contemporary homes provide a diverse range of options.
Properties rarely become available, reinforcing a sense of exclusivity and community stability. Transaction volumes are low by design, but buyer interest remains durable, particularly for meticulously maintained estates with substantial plots.
A Place to Live and Invest in Oisterwijk
Purchasing a high-value residence in Oisterwijk is driven as much by lifestyle as by investment priorities. Homebuyers are attracted by the area’s celebrated forest setting, proximity to major Dutch cities, and strong local community ethos. Many opt for principal homes, while a significant number also acquire secondary residences for weekend retreats. Generational purchases are common, with buyers focusing on long-term family legacy and privacy.
The local property market is transparent, with structured purchase timelines. Transactions typically involve clear due diligence, often assisted by recognized legal professionals and specialists in historic real estate. The buying process adheres to established national guidelines, ensuring both buyer and seller security. Ownership structures are straightforward, with freehold occupancy most common. International buyers are well accommodated, with reputable agencies facilitating property search, negotiation, and compliance with local regulations. Due to demand, private sales and off-market deals are not unusual, especially in the premium segment.

Life in Oisterwijk is defined by access to nature, with extensive walking and cycling paths meandering through protected forests and lakes. Boutique shopping, celebrated restaurants, and seasonal cultural events contribute to an enriching everyday experience.
Residents often participate in community initiatives, art exhibitions, and sports clubs, fostering a strong local identity. The town’s sophisticated yet understated social life appeals to those valuing privacy and quietly luxurious surroundings, while its proximity to larger cities extends opportunities for business, art, and travel.
Oisterwijk enjoys a temperate maritime climate, with mild summers and cool winters. Seasonal changes are gently marked, supporting year-round outdoor living and leisure.
Spring and autumn bring lush foliage changes in the renowned woodlands, while summers are ideal for lakeside activities and alfresco dining. The well-balanced weather enhances Oisterwijk’s reputation as both a seasonal getaway and a permanent residence.

There are no legal restrictions on foreign ownership of property in the Netherlands. International buyers are free to purchase homes in Oisterwijk, though prudent due diligence and legal guidance are advisable.
